Sheer Curtains
PROS: If you are redecorating a dimly lit space, consider sheer curtains because they allow the most light into the room. A timeless look, sheer curtains work well with any decor styleand fit in nicely with patterns. They also create a romantic look in the bedroom. Perhaps best of all, they can always be paired with a room darkeningor blackout style.

CONS: Sheer curtains do not provide as much privacy as other styles and do not block light or drafts for energy efficiency.

Regular Window Curtains and Room Darkening Curtains
PROS: This is the normal style of curtains because it filters most natural light but still lets some in. During the colder months, it also blocks some of the draft. They are available in many different colors, patterns and fabrics, making it easy to find the perfect window panels for your room.

CONS: If you need to take a midday nap on a sunny day, you will need a sleeping mask.

Blackout Curtains
PROS: These are the most energy efficient style of them all. They completely block the heat and sunlight on warm, sunny days and the draft on cold and windy days. Blackout curtains are made with high quality heavier materials. This style provides complete privacy.

CONS: Blackout curtains can be more expensive than the other styles. The type of window treatments you choose has a great bearing on the look of the room you're redecorating.
